Structural Rot Repair in Longmont, CO

Structural rot repair involves identifying and restoring wood and other building materials that have been compromised by moisture, fungi, or pests, leading to weakened structural integrity. This service typically covers projects such as repairing or replacing rotted beams, joists, framing, or support posts in residential properties. Homeowners often want to understand the signs of structural rot, such as sagging floors, warped wood, or visible mold, and seek guidance on the extent of damage before requesting repairs.

Before requesting structural rot repair, property owners usually want to know the scope of work needed to restore safety and stability to the building. It's important to assess whether the damage is localized or widespread and to understand the potential costs involved. Proper evaluation can help determine if additional repairs or preventative measures are necessary to protect the property from future issues related to moisture intrusion or pest activity.

Project Types

Common Structural Rot Repair Jobs

Wood framing repair - addressing damaged or rotted wooden structures to restore stability.

Floor joist reinforcement - replacing or sistering compromised joists to ensure safe support.

Wall framing restoration - repairing or replacing rotted wall components for structural integrity.

Foundation beam repair - fixing rotted foundation beams to prevent further settling or shifting.

Porch and deck support repair - restoring rotted supports to maintain safety and durability.

Structural assessment services - evaluating damage to determine the extent of rot and necessary repairs.

FAQ

Structural Rot Repair Questions

What causes structural rot in buildings? Structural rot is typically caused by prolonged exposure to moisture, which leads to wood decay and weakening of building components.

How can I tell if my property has structural rot? Signs include soft or spongy wood, visible mold or fungi, and sagging or warped surfaces in affected areas.

What types of projects often require structural rot repair? Common projects include foundation support repairs, deck reinforcement, and repairing damaged beams or framing.

Why is timely repair important for structural rot? Addressing rot promptly helps prevent further damage, maintains building stability, and reduces the risk of costly repairs later.
